2920 in Roman Numerals

The number 2920 written in Roman numerals is MMCMXX.

2920
=
MMCMXX

How MMCMXX is built:

MM= 2000
CM= 900
XX= 20
MMCMXX= 2920

What is the range of Roman numerals?
Standard Roman numerals cover 1 to 3,999 (I to MMMCMXCIX). Numbers outside this range cannot be represented with the classic seven symbols: I, V, X, L, C, D, M.
